PFAS-free, always.
PFAS (per- and polyfluoroalkyl substances) are perennial pollutants, used for their water-repellent and non-stick properties, are persistent chemical pollutants with serious ecological and health effects, associated with cancers, hormonal disorders and immune system damage.
The outdoor industry is particularly concerned, especially through waterproof membranes and water-repellent treatments. However, from the very beginning of Lagoped, we made a radical decision: no PFAS in our products . Thanks to our partners, such as Sympatex , we use a waterproof membrane and a water-repellent treatment guaranteed to be PFAS-free .


The first textile brand to publish its eco-score, since 2023.
At Lagoped , we believe transparency is essential for more responsible fashion. That's why we're the first textile brand to publish the Ecoscore of our clothing, based on rigorous methods such as the European Product Environmental Footprint (PEF) and the French Ecobalyse . These analyses allow us to measure the impact of each product throughout its life cycle and compare it to a market benchmark.
Learn more
With 3.3 billion textile items sold in France in 2022 , the environmental impact of the industry is colossal: more greenhouse gas emissions than air and maritime traffic combined , and 4% of global drinking water consumption (source: Ministry of Ecological Transition, 2023). Faced with these challenges, we have chosen to display our ecological performance in a clear and accessible way, in partnership with PEF Trust , so that you can make informed choices.

Key Dates


2017/2018/2019
2017: Design of the first EVE jacket, the first stone of the project.
2018: Lagoped officially comes into being and sells its first EVE jacket.
2019: Immediate success: the EVE jacket wins the Gold Winner award at ISPO Munich, recognizing the best outdoor products of the year.
Launch of the Lagoped Family


2020
The TETRAS jacket won the Sustainability Award at the French Outdoor Awards organized by Outdoor Sports Valley.
Development of the first pants, backpacks and new technical pieces (Rypa, Phantom, etc.).


2023
Lagoped becomes the first French textile brand to publish the eco-score on its entire collection according to the methodology of the European Commission (2023) then of the Ministry of Ecological Transition (France, 2024)
In September, Lagoped raised 5.7 million euros to accelerate its development.
First pop-up store with Au Vieux Campeur in Paris, 38 rue des Écoles.


2024
Opening of the Annecy office, in the Glaisins park.
Reopening of the Au Vieux Campeur pop-up, at 42 rue des Écoles.
A key step: opening of the first Lagoped store, Le Refuge Chamonix .
